Vulnerabilities in Firebook

I want to warn you about Insufficient Anti-automation, Abuse of
Functionality, Information Leakage and Cross-Site Scripting vulnerabilities
in Firebook.

SecurityVulns ID: 11396.

-------------------------
Affected products:
-------------------------

Vulnerable are Firebook 3.100328 and previous versions.

----------
Details:
----------

Insufficient Anti-automation (WASC-21):

http://site/index.html?mailto=MG1112008878;file=path/to/guestbook/message.html;

There is no protection from automated requests (captcha) at page for sending
message to e-mail. The referer is checking at visiting of the page.

Abuse of Functionality (WASC-42):

At sending of a message in form for sending to e-mail, it's sending not only
to owner of e-mail, which wrote the message on the site, but also to 
specified sender's e-mail. Which can be used for sending spam to arbitrary 
e-mails (Spam Gateway).

Information Leakage (WASC-13):

http://site/env/index.html

Leakage of full path at server and other information.

XSS (WASC-08):

http://site/env/index.html?%3Cscript%3Ealert(document.cookie)%3C/script%3E
